Where to Find the Best Salons and Spas
Shadyside & East Liberty
These adjacent neighborhoods are home to Pittsburgh's most established and upscale salons and day spas. Walnut Street in Shadyside features polished, full-service salons with master colorists, while East Liberty houses modern wellness studios offering cutting-edge facials and med-spa services in a chic setting.
Lawrenceville
Butler Street is the heart of Pittsburgh's indie beauty scene. Here, you'll find stylist-owned boutiques specializing in balayage, vivid colors, and textured cuts. The vibe is artistic, personalized, and often more appointment-only, with many stylists booking directly through their professional profiles.
Downtown & Cultural District
Downtown caters to professionals with convenient, high-end salons offering express services and blowouts. The spas here tend to be luxurious, hotel-based retreats perfect for pre-theatre massages or a full day of pampering before a show at the Benedum Center.
South Hills (Mt. Lebanon, Dormont)
The South Hills suburbs have a concentration of family-friendly, service-oriented salons and spas. These spots often excel in traditional cuts, color correction, and relaxing environments that feel like a neighborhood escape.
Tips for Booking in Pittsburgh
- Book Ahead for Special Occasions: Salons near universities (Oakland) and in popular neighborhoods book up for graduation, weddings, and holidays months in advance. Plan accordingly.
- Consultations are Crucial for Color: Given Pittsburgh's variable water quality (which can affect color), a pre-service consultation is highly recommended for any major color change.
- Look for Local Product Lines: Many top salons and spas carry products from Pittsburgh-based skincare and hair care makers, offering a unique, locally-sourced experience.
